svgson-lite@1.0.4
Malicious code in svgson-lite (npm)
T1195.002 · Compromise Software Supply ChainT1059.007 · JavaScriptT1105 · Ingress Tool TransferT1102 · Web ServiceT1071.001 · Web Protocols
Analysis
svgson-lite@1.0.4 is a trojanized SVG helper that contains a remote code execution backdoor. The exported getPlugin() function fetches content from hxxps://shorturl[.]at/147uq and executes it via eval(), allowing the remote server to run arbitrary JavaScript code in the context of any application that imports this package. The backdoor is hidden among legitimate SVG utility functions (isSvg, getSvgSize, removeComments, etc.).
